Definition and Functionality


A sanitary pneumatic butterfly valve is a quarter-turn valve that uses a rotating disc (the “butterfly”) to control the flow of fluids within a pipeline. The disc is mounted on a shaft, which, when turned, opens or closes the flow path. The term “sanitary” denotes that the valve is specifically designed to meet strict hygiene standards, making it suitable for applications that require sanitary processing. These valves are typically constructed from stainless steel and feature smooth surfaces that minimize the risk of contamination.


The pneumatic aspect refers to the use of compressed air to actuate the valve’s movement. Pneumatic actuators are advantageous in environments where rapid operation is necessary, providing quick opening and closing of the valve. This feature is particularly beneficial in processes requiring precise flow control, such as in the food processing industry, where maintaining product integrity is crucial.


Design and Construction


Sanitary pneumatic butterfly valves are engineered to facilitate rapid cleaning and maintenance. They often incorporate a tri-clamp connection, which allows for easy assembly and disassembly without special tools. This design is essential in industries that must adhere to strict sanitation protocols, as it enables thorough cleaning between batches to prevent cross-contamination.


Moreover, the materials used in the construction of these valves are selected for their resistance to corrosion and ease of cleaning. Stainless steel, especially grades 304 and 316, is commonly used due to its durability, resistance to rusting, and ability to withstand harsh cleaning chemicals and high temperatures.


Applications

Sanitary pneumatic butterfly valves are extensively used across various industries. In the food and beverage industry, they control the flow of liquids such as juices, beers, and sauces. Their ability to maintain clean conditions while providing effective flow control makes them ideal for these applications. They are also utilized in dairy processing for products like milk and cheese, where hygiene is non-negotiable.


In pharmaceutical manufacturing, these valves play a critical role in ensuring product purity. With the stringent regulations governing the production of pharmaceuticals, the sanitation features of pneumatic butterfly valves help manufacturers meet compliance standards while maintaining operational efficiency.


Chemical processing industries also benefit from sanitary pneumatic butterfly valves. They can handle corrosive and viscous fluids, making them suitable for various chemical applications. The ability to adapt to different environments further adds to their appeal, allowing for seamless integration into diverse processing systems.


Benefits


One of the primary advantages of sanitary pneumatic butterfly valves is their low-pressure drop. As the valve opens, the flow path remains largely unobstructed, allowing for efficient flow with minimal resistance. This characteristic is particularly important in industries where maintaining pressure and flow rates is critical.


Additionally, the pneumatic actuation provides speed and responsiveness, allowing operators to quickly adjust flow rates as needed. This rapid control is vital in processes where product characteristics may change frequently, necessitating real-time adjustments to maintain quality.


The ease of maintenance associated with sanitary pneumatic butterfly valves cannot be overstated. Their design enables quick disassembly for cleaning and inspection, facilitating compliance with sanitation regulations while reducing downtime in production.
